Yeah i just wanted to know which format - *.lsz or *.zip is to be preferred while uploading themes to ls.net.
i have uploaded using *.lsz and some users say that the file gets corrupted.
lsz is better cuz double clicking directly installs the theme.
one suggestion was to put the lsz inside a zip, but that may confuse newbiews??
any suggestions...

Posted by member 1 on 2003-10-14 07:42:40 link

All files in the upload processes will be renamed to .zip no matter what you upload them as. We have changed the upload script to allow for .lsz and .lst but we still create our own file names.
